Fruit, fruit ,fruit!

Ever since i was sleeved 6 weeks ago all i crave or want to eat is fruit. All kinds of fruit, melon, berries, peaches, grapes, apples.... All other food just sounds blah to me. If i do eat a few bites, it sits just fine and i have no problems with that. Just wondering if this is trying to tell me something that I'm really lacking in my diet, or if it's just simply i want fruit. Any ideas?
